Navy assists transfer of injured fisherman rescued through coordination of MRCC Colombo

The Sri Lanka Navy rendered assistance to bring ashore an injured fisherman, who was aboard a local multi day fishing trawler at sea south-east of Sri Lanka, about 179 nautical miles (331km) off Kirinda. The fisherman was brought to the Offshore Patrol Limit of Galle, on being coordinated by the Maritime Rescue Coordination Centre (MRCC) Colombo. After being brought ashore today (23rd October 2024), he was rushed to the Teaching Hospital of Karapitiya, for medical attention by the Navy.

Navy nabs 02 persons for illegal night diving in the eastern seas

The Navy apprehended 02 persons who engaged in illegal night diving in the sea area of Sallikovil, Trincomalee, during a search operation conducted on 21st October 2024. The operation also led to the seizure of 01 boat, diving gear and fishing equipment used for this illegal activity.

Two (2) suspects with Kerala cannabis valued over Rs. 6 million held in Chavakachcheri

A search operation conducted by the Navy and Police in the Maniththalei area of Chavakachcheri on 19th October 2024 led to the arrest of two suspects and seizure of about 15kg and 055g of Kerala cannabis and one dinghy.

Over 33kg of Kerala cannabis valued more than Rs. 13 million seized

In separate operations on 17th October 2024, the Sri Lanka Navy, in coordination with the Police Special Task Force (STF) in Talaimannar, and acting independently on Kachchativu Island, seized approximately 33kg and 88g of Kerala cannabis (wet weight). One of the operations also led to the arrest of a suspect in connection with the possession of the illicit substance.

Navy assists transfer of ill fisherman rescued through coordination of MRCC Colombo

The Sri Lanka Navy rendered assistance to bring ashore an ill fisherman, who was aboard a local multi day fishing trawler on the high seas south-west of Sri Lanka, about 881 nautical miles (1631km) off Dondra. Initially, the fisherman was retrieved by a Merchant Vessel in the sea area, on being coordinated by the Maritime Rescue Coordination Centre (MRCC) Colombo. After being brought ashore today (15th October 2024), he was rushed to the National Hospital of Colombo, for medical attention.

Navy mobilizes resources to support communities affected by flood

Due to the heavy rainfall caused by adverse weather conditions affecting the island, several areas in the Western and Northwestern Provinces are experiencing floods. To assist those impacted, 07 Navy flood relief teams are engaged in relief operations in those areas as of today (15th October 2024). Working in coordination with the Disaster Management Center (DMC), Navy flood relief teams are continuously carrying out relief efforts in the Gampaha, Colombo and Puttalam districts.
